Angela Nissel is the author of 2 best-selling books “The Broke Diaries” and “Mixed”. She was the first Black staff writer on "Scrubs" and since has written and produced for shows like “The Boondocks”, “Ginny & Georgia” and “The Other Black Girl”.
Angela has staffed in writers’ rooms for over 25 years, produced more than 150 episodes of television, and recently made her first foray into film and co-wrote the 2025 Toni Braxton Lifetime movie, “Man Enough”.
She joined Dr. Peterson to discuss her memoir being released in April 2026 — “Good Grief, Pass The Bread, Mom Is Dead”, and her overall illustrious media career.
